Algebra is such a wide-encompassing range of various mathematical equations that it is easy for a student to get lost when expected to explain synthetic division or adding fractions . For that matter, letters are heavily used for replacing the numbers when it comes to algebra. While this isn’t highly complicated in and of itself, it brings itself poorly to the ‘jump in and play’ aspect of some mathematics. Simply speaking, if a person is supposed to execute a particular algebraic task, he or she should be aware of the algebraic tasks that led to it. This is to say that Algebra is a process that takes mastery of every step in order to progress. A pupil can’t hope for finding square root radicals and roots when he or she has not learned proportions and ratios, or converting measures and units.
